cheezstik
There is a big difference between being able to play AR10, and being able to read it. I could get AR9.8 FC's at an early rank by just reacting to the circles, but even now I can't completely read AR9.8. Like the others said, you will have little use for AR10 for a long time unless you plan on playing HR primarily, which I don't see you doing with your relatively low overall accuracy, unless you want to improve that as well, which would come before learning AR10.

Anyway, if you still insist on learning AR10, the only thing you can really do is play more AR10. I randomly tried AR9.6 one day and I could magically read it just fine after not much getting used to it, but with AR10, even after ages of trying to practice it, I still can't read it completely. You just have to let your eyes get used to it. If you can't play with the HP drain / high OD of HR, then just edit the AR.

Something you can do to counter-act forgetting low AR's is playing a wide range of AR songs, 8-10, and I like to even play insanes on EZ every now and then just to keep my reading trained at all levels.
E m i
well, obviously practice
ar8 + dt = ar9.67
ar7 + hr = ar9.8
ar10 = ar10
maybe do it in that order, maybe go back to ar8-9 sometimes, maybe play more.
you don't need to practice high AR's a lot specifically. Playing more, getting more used to this game, and all this sheet will be useful, too.

Zare
I'm rank 2k and can't read AR10 properly
There's absolutely ZERO benefit from trying to learn AR10 at your level
You need AR10 for exactly two things:

HR on Insanes (including OD10 and HP~9 and CS5)
AR10 Nomod maps (which tend to be around 6 stars at the least)

None of this is in any way near your skill level, you would just be wasting your time if you tried to force AR10
rank 3k~2k is actually a pretty good point to start caring about AR10



Now the above only applies if you're serious about improving and skill. if you just want to derp around and have fun with high AR, just play it, no one will judge you. Edit maps to whatever AR you want or play ridiculous NoFail maps
